Transaction 54c9309b9bf4174e79a5e12f801926902a0699075c33676630a3f76a47adf18a
1 Input
1 Output
-
54c9309b9bf4174e79a5e12f801926902a0699075c33676630a3f76a47adf18a:0
- value
- 1077685
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ef6371b2f601c2e146e8c4a29a5fabb5627bf95
- address
- bc1q0mmrwxe0vqwzu9rw339znf06hdtz00u46dlrph